About

Bruno Frank Codispoti is a litigation attorney with more than 37 years of legal experience, practicing at Codispoti & Associates, P. C. in New York, NY. He earned a degree from New York Law School Juris Doctor in 1989. He has been admitted to the New York Bar since 1989. His practice encompasses litigation, business, intellectual property, and real estate,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. In addition to English, he is proficient in Italian.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
